Town Park in Dix Hills, NY, offers pet owners and their furry friends a peaceful spot to enjoy the outdoors together. This dog-friendly area is an extension of the Edgewood Preserve and features scenic pet-friendly trails that wind through the natural landscape. With beautiful views overlooking the town yard and surrounding hills, it’s a popular location for dog-friendly hiking near Dix Hills, New York.
Visitors note that the park is peaceful and generally well-kept, providing a comfortable space for both dogs and families. Kids are welcome, making it a great choice for those looking to combine family outings with exercise for their pets. While small in size, Town Park is a convenient option for locals seeking a natural wilderness escape right in the heart of Dix Hills.
